Output 81f5d10c4b15f463ed31f1e435179bbfdd1a5659c7f4d069de0b93261343c4e7:1

value
35130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bc81f4dfc46892e01cc53125e4141e3fb5fede OP_EQUAL
address
3MMj2XaD7Qp7ckpRcjydiVQ5eHr88y137U
transaction
81f5d10c4b15f463ed31f1e435179bbfdd1a5659c7f4d069de0b93261343c4e7
spent
true